**Q: How do I validate the podcast feed before cutting a release?**

Run the Fernquill validator against the staging feed. It checks enclosure sizes, episode GUID uniqueness, and artwork dimensions. A red result blocks the release; yellow warnings are your call. Don't skip it for hotfixes—malformed feeds take hours to purge from caches. Full flag reference and exit codes are documented on the internal page here.

dashboard of tahop-fahof = https://harbor.tolvaqnet.example/secrets/merge_requests/board/issue/merge_requests/pipeline/secrets/ecb30ed86a55c001a77f6cb9

**Q: The Fennick turnstile counter at Braywood Stadium stopped reporting — what now?**

First, don't panic: the counters buffer locally for up to four hours. Check the gate-sync dashboard; if a whole gate bank is dark, restart the collector service from the kiosk in the ops room. The kiosk boots into a locked recovery shell after power loss, and it will ask for the recovery passphrase, shown directly below this entry.

recovery phrase for fawif-tajeg: norael-aldmir-casir-brivan-ulaion

Handover: Coldvault archiving. Taking over from me, short version: the archiver sweeps cold storage buckets nightly, moves anything untouched for 180 days to glacier tier, and deletes tombstoned objects after 30 more. Don't touch the sweep schedule without checking the billing export first — Marl learned that the hard way. Lifecycle rules live in the service, not the bucket policies. Logs go to the usual place. Current production configuration for the archiver is below.

deployment values, yadug-bawif:
[framir]
team = pelox
access_code = ac_a38ab2
owner = tamion.julael
host = framir.tolvaqlabs.test
port = 11211
peer = tammir.zemvargrid.local
salt = 2215ef03
pin = 1541

Subject: Scheduled key rotation — Spokewise rebalancer

Hi,

As part of our quarterly review, we are rotating the credential the Spokewise rebalancing tool uses to query dock occupancy from the internal Fleetmap service. The old key will be revoked 72 hours after this notice; both keys remain valid during the overlap so the truck-routing jobs are not interrupted. Rotation was performed with dual approval and logged in the audit trail. The replacement key is below.

API key for yahig-tadup: kto7_ubizbYm